St. Bartholomew — Journey with the Saints

WebAug 15, 2024 · To the right of Christ, you can see St. Bartholomew with his flayed skin. Most scholars agree that the face in the skin is that of Michelangelo, a self portrait. Some speculate this was a reflection of Michelangelo's anguish at being forced to paint yet again. WebAug 27, 2007 · This detail is of St. Bartholomew from the Last Judgment (1536-41). It was in the figure of St. Bartholomew, the martyr who was flayed alive, that Michelangelo chose … WebSt. Bartholomew converted the Armenian King Polymius to Christianity. According to tradition, St. Bartholomew was skinned alive and beheaded by the king’s enraged brother, who feared political repercussions. As a symbol of his gruesome martyrdom, St. Bartholomew in artwork often holds his own flayed skin; here, he holds the knife. burrous dozer \\u0026 dirt service huntington

WebSt Bartholomew is the most prominent flayed Christian martyr. During the 16th century, images of the flaying of Bartholomew were so popular that it came to signify the saint in works of art. Consequently, Saint Bartholomew is most often represented being skinned alive. Symbols associated with the saint include knives (alluding to the knife used ...
